ロードバランス先設定変更
API情報
| API種別 | メソッド | URI | 対象 | 名称 | 実行 |
|---|---|---|---|---|---|
| 設定 | PUT | /:GisServiceCode/best-effort-fw-lbs/:IlbServiceCode/lb/destinations/:Id.json | FW+LBベストエフォートタイプ | ロードバランス先設定変更 | 同期 |
- 指定したFW+LB ベストエフォートタイプのロードバランス先情報を変更します
リクエストパラメータ
| パラメータ | 必須 | 意味 | 値 | |
|---|---|---|---|---|
|
URL
|
GisServiceCode | ○ | P2契約のサービスコード | gis######## |
| IlbServiceCode | ○ | FW+LB ベストエフォートタイプのサービスコード | ilb######## | |
| Id | ○ | ロードバランス先を一意に識別するID | 数字 | |
| ボディ | Weight | ロードバランス先重み Failover がNoのときは必須、Yesのときは指定できない |
数字 |
|
| Enabled | ○ | 有効・無効 | "Yes" "No" |
レスポンス
| フィールド | タイプ | 意味 | 値 |
|---|---|---|---|
| Current | Object | 変更後のロードバランス先情報 | オブジェクト |
| Current.Weight | String | ロードバランス先重み Failover がYesのときは空 |
数字 |
| Current.Enabled | String | 有効・無効 | "Yes" "No" |
| Previous | Object | 変更前のロードバランス先情報 | オブジェクト |
| Previous.Weight | String | ロードバランス先重み Failover がYesのときは空 |
数字 |
| Previous.Enabled | String | 有効・無効 | "Yes" "No" |
制限
- 特になし
サンプル
リクエストボディ
{
"Weight": "100",
"Enabled": 'Yes"
}
レスポンス (JSON)
{ |
"RequestId": "xxxxxxxx-xxxxxxxx-xxxxxxxx-xxxxxxxx-xxxxxxxx", |
"Current": { |
"Weight": "100", |
"Enabled": "Yes" |
}, |
"Previous": { |
"Weight": "1", |
"Enabled": "No" |
} |
} |